Synthflow

Best forSmall real estate appraisal teams or solo appraisers who need basic call automation at a low price point and are comfortable with limited personalization.

According to their website, Synthflow is an AI-powered virtual receptionist platform designed for small businesses across multiple industries, including real estate. It enables 24/7 call handling with customizable AI agents that can answer questions, take messages, and schedule appointments. The platform supports integration with a single calendar system—primarily Calendly—and allows users to set business hours, define call routing rules, and manage multiple phone numbers. Synthflow uses generic AI voice technology, which, while functional, lacks the emotional depth and natural rhythm of more advanced systems. It offers basic call analytics, including call duration, volume, and answer rates, and allows users to review transcripts. The platform is designed for ease of use, with a drag-and-drop interface for building call flows and setting up responses. According to their site, Synthflow is ideal for businesses that want a simple, affordable way to automate phone answering without complex setup. However, it does not support long-term caller memory, so each interaction starts fresh, and it lacks advanced features like post-call summaries or integration with multiple calendar platforms. Despite its limitations, Synthflow remains a viable option for real estate appraisers who need basic call automation at a low entry cost.

My AI Front Desk

Best forReal estate appraisers with moderate call volume who need a simple, low-cost solution for handling after-hours calls and basic scheduling.

According to their website, My AI Front Desk is a virtual receptionist service that uses AI to answer phone calls, take messages, and schedule appointments for small businesses. It supports integration with a single calendar platform and allows users to customize greeting messages and response scripts. The platform is marketed as a cost-effective alternative to human receptionists, with a focus on handling high-volume call traffic during peak hours. It provides basic call logs and summary reports, and users can access transcripts via a web dashboard. The AI voice is described as natural-sounding, though it does not leverage the most advanced voice models available. According to their site, the platform is suitable for professionals in real estate, legal services, and healthcare. However, it does not offer long-term memory or semantic understanding of callers, meaning each interaction is treated as isolated. It also lacks integration with multiple calendar systems, limiting flexibility for users with complex scheduling needs. While the platform is functional for basic call handling, its lack of personalization and limited feature set make it less effective for real estate appraisers who rely on relationship-building and follow-up.

Aiva

Best forReal estate appraisers who need a reliable, automated system for call routing and basic scheduling with minimal setup.

According to their website, Aiva is a virtual receptionist platform that uses AI to handle incoming calls and route them to the right person. It supports integration with Calendly and allows users to set business hours, define call flows, and manage multiple phone numbers. The platform offers a customizable AI voice and provides call transcripts, summaries, and analytics. It also includes a feature to detect voicemails and send automated follow-ups. Aiva is designed for small businesses in real estate, legal, and medical fields. However, it does not support long-term caller memory or semantic understanding, so each call is treated independently. The platform lacks integration with multiple calendar systems beyond Calendly, limiting its flexibility. While it offers basic appointment booking, it does not support real-time availability checks or automatic confirmation emails. According to their site, Aiva is best suited for businesses that want a straightforward, automated phone system without complex setup. For real estate appraisers, this means handling calls and scheduling appointments, but with less personalization and fewer advanced features compared to more robust platforms.

Voiceflow

Best forTech-savvy real estate appraisers or agencies with development resources who want full control over their virtual receptionist’s behavior.

According to their website, Voiceflow is a no-code platform for building voice and chat AI agents, including virtual receptionists. It allows users to design conversational flows using a visual builder and deploy them on phone systems via Twilio. The platform supports integration with Calendly and Google Calendar, enabling basic appointment booking. It also offers call analytics, transcripts, and customizable greetings. Voiceflow is highly flexible and powerful, making it suitable for developers and non-technical users alike. However, it requires more technical setup than fully managed platforms and does not include pre-built templates for real estate use cases. The AI voice is generic and lacks the emotional intelligence and natural pacing of advanced models. According to their site, Voiceflow is ideal for teams that want full control over their AI agent’s behavior and are willing to invest time in configuration. For real estate appraisers, this means the ability to create a custom receptionist that handles property inquiries and scheduling—but only if they have the time or resources to build it. Without pre-built workflows, setup can take hours or days, and the lack of long-term memory means callers must repeat themselves. While powerful, Voiceflow is not a turnkey solution for real estate professionals seeking immediate results.
